Located in Talkeetna, this charming cabin for $192 per night is a great choice for your next vacation. Summary: Kick back and relax in this stylish artsy and rustic cabin getaway centrally located within walking distance to downtown and train depot. A 5 minute walk to the town of Talkeetna for good food and plenty of fun services including flight seeing, white water river rafting and Alaska’s world famous fishing. Lodge includes 2 king size beds, a pullout sofa, WiFi, self check-in, AppleTV (Netflix, Hulu, and Disney+), complimentary Keurig coffee and tea bar, free parking, private entrance. The Space: The cabin is an large space with a full kitchen, laundry room, and a master suite with plenty of storage space . There are 2 dedicated bedrooms, a pull-out couch and One full bathrooms. Upstairs living space for gathering around the kitchen table for games and puzzles, and a full kitchen for making any meals you'd like. The downstairs TV room is great for reading, relaxing, or watching Netflix, Hulu, or Disney+ (all complimentary with your stay). We have onsite caretakers that live on the property site that can help assist with anything you might need during your stay. Guest Access: 1500+ square feet of cozy open floor plan space. Private balcony attached to the second floor west end of the lodge. The Neighborhood: Talkeetna is a small unique town with great restaurants, breweries, and nightlife. Walking trails behind the home for a shortcut to downtown. All downtown attractions and restaurants are within 0.5-0.7 miles. Train depot is 0.7 miles away. Getting Around: Convenient location and within a half-mile walking distance of downtown restaurants, nightlife, and rail depot. We provide access to two bikes from June to September. Brother Bear is beautiful & immaculate. There has been great effort in the conversion to a guest house. However, the set up seemed a bit awkward.
Photos are accurate - first level had a sitting room (pull out sofa bed) the only bedroom & laundry. The stairs leading to the second level were uneven. The first step quite high and the last step in the flight - short. (Honestly, coming down the stairs and getting to the last step, we all used caution.)
The second level contained the kitchen & dining & 4 chairs AND the bathroom. Plenty of nice quality towels and additional toiletries available. At the far end of second level is a small landing to sit and enjoy the fresh air. From this second level was a spiral staircase that lead to a loft. Getting luggage up the stairs was tricky. I elected to leave one of my suitcases on the second floor & only take the small piece to the third level. Linens were of quality and beds comfortable.
We spent the majority of our time on this second level. It was the most open and "social" area. It was unfortunate that this main space did not have a TV. The room is long & has wasted space. Well equipped kitchen - Hi-quality everything. We contributed some spices and condiments with our stay -normal pass along. There was only ONE wine glass.
We enjoyed our peaceful time at Brother Bear and the little Chalet town of Talkeetna. Would stay again. Not much to do & that was just fine! Town folk were very friendly.
